Event Coordinator: With a 25% share of the market, event coordinators are essential in ensuring smooth event execution. They collaborate with clients, suppliers, and internal teams to plan and coordinate every aspect of an event, from logistics and vendor management to on-site supervision. Contract Manager: Contract managers oversee the drafting, negotiation, and execution of contracts with clients and suppliers. They account for 30% of the market and play a vital role in mitigating risks, ensuring compliance, and maintaining positive business relationships. Event Planner: Event planners focus on designing and creating memorable and engaging events, accounting for 20% of the market. They collaborate with clients to understand their goals, develop creative concepts, and execute them flawlessly. Procurement Specialist: Procurement specialists are responsible for sourcing and managing suppliers, accounting for 15% of the market. They ensure that the organization obtains goods and services at the best possible cost, quality, and delivery terms. Legal Advisor: Legal advisors contribute to 10% of the market and provide counsel on various legal matters related to event contracts. They review, revise, and draft contracts, ensuring that they align with industry regulations and protect the organization's interests.
